Front Cover; Half-title page; Title Page; Copyright; Contents; Family Business; Characters; ACT ONE; ACT TWO.;Retired entrepreneur William invites his four grown-up children to visit his beautiful converted barn in the Welsh Borders to celebrate his birthday. They all join with William's carer Solomon to toast another year, but each of them has their own business in mind ... Warm, intelligent, witty and moving, Family Business is the world premiere production of Julian Mitchell's new play, looking at the complex relationships that underpin family life.'a very clever play, and a witty one as well ... The succession of one-liners flows copiously' 4 stars - What's On Stage 'Julian Mitchell is part of a vanishing breed: the fastidious craftsman who knows how to explore ideas while generating suspense. It is clear that the play is, in part, a modern-day Lear ... immensely watchable' - The Guardian.
